Paul A. Wehry, 77, of Ashland passed away Tuesday morning February 3, 2026 at his home surrounded by his loving family.
Born in Ashland on April 7, 1948 he was the son of the late Ada F. (Lesher) and Joseph M. Wehry.
For over 55 years Paul was the husband of Joan M. (Kerstetter) Wehry, they were married in 1970.
He was of the Protestant faith. Paul graduated from Tri Valley High School in 1966. He worked as a welder for Bear Ridge Machine & Fabrication in Frackville before retiring in October 2009. Paul was also a farmer raising steer and harvesting grain all of his life.
Paul loved farming, nature, butchering, and eating. His famous saying was “pain is the best teacher”.
